    def process_takes(self, updates_of_take_to_be_published, package_id, original_of_take_to_be_published=None):
        """
        Primary rule for publishing a Take in Takes Package is: all previous takes must be published before a take
        can be published.

        This method validates if the take(s) previous to this article are published. If not published then raises error.
        Also, generates body_html of the takes package and make sure the metadata for the package is the same as the
        metadata of the take to be published.

        :param updates_of_take_to_be_published: The take to be published
        :return: Takes Package document and body_html of the Takes Package
        :raises:
            1. Article Not Found Error: If take identified by GUID in the Takes Package is not found in archive.
            2. Previous Take Not Published Error
        """

        package = super().find_one(req=None, _id=package_id)
        body_html = updates_of_take_to_be_published.get('body_html', original_of_take_to_be_published['body_html'])
        package_updates = {'body_html': body_html + '<br>'}

        groups = package.get('groups', [])
        if groups:
            take_refs = [ref for group in groups if group['id'] == 'main' for ref in group.get('refs')]
            sequence_num_of_take_to_be_published = 0

            take_article_id = updates_of_take_to_be_published.get(
                config.ID_FIELD, original_of_take_to_be_published[config.ID_FIELD])

            for r in take_refs:
                if r[GUID_FIELD] == take_article_id:
                    sequence_num_of_take_to_be_published = r[SEQUENCE]
                    break

            if sequence_num_of_take_to_be_published:
                if self.published_state != "killed":
                    for sequence in range(sequence_num_of_take_to_be_published, 0, -1):
                        previous_take_ref = next(ref for ref in take_refs if ref.get(SEQUENCE) == sequence)
                        if previous_take_ref[GUID_FIELD] != take_article_id:
                            previous_take = super().find_one(req=None, _id=previous_take_ref[GUID_FIELD])

                            if not previous_take:
                                raise PublishQueueError.article_not_found_error(
                                    Exception("Take with id %s not found" % previous_take_ref[GUID_FIELD]))

                            if previous_take and previous_take[config.CONTENT_STATE] not in ['published', 'corrected']:
                                raise PublishQueueError.previous_take_not_published_error(
                                    Exception("Take with id {} is not published in Takes Package with id {}"
                                              .format(previous_take_ref[GUID_FIELD], package[config.ID_FIELD])))

                            package_updates['body_html'] = \
                                previous_take['body_html'] + '<br>' + package_updates['body_html']

                metadata_tobe_copied = ['headline', 'abstract', 'anpa_category', 'pubstatus', 'slugline', 'urgency',
                                        'subject', 'byline', 'dateline']

                for metadata in metadata_tobe_copied:
                    package_updates[metadata] = \
                        updates_of_take_to_be_published.get(metadata, original_of_take_to_be_published.get(metadata))

        return package, package_updates

    def _validate(self, original, updates):
        self.raise_if_invalid_state_transition(original)

        updated = original.copy()
        updated.update(updates)

        self.raise_if_not_marked_for_publication(updated)

        takes_package = self.takes_package_service.get_take_package(original)

        if self.publish_type == 'publish':
            # validate if take can be published
            if takes_package and not self.takes_package_service.can_publish_take(
                    takes_package, updates.get(SEQUENCE, original.get(SEQUENCE, 1))):
                raise PublishQueueError.previous_take_not_published_error(
                    Exception("Previous takes are not published."))

            update_schedule_settings(updated, PUBLISH_SCHEDULE, updated.get(PUBLISH_SCHEDULE))
            validate_schedule(updated.get(SCHEDULE_SETTINGS, {}).get('utc_{}'.format(PUBLISH_SCHEDULE)),
                              takes_package.get(SEQUENCE, 1) if takes_package else 1)

        if original[ITEM_TYPE] != CONTENT_TYPE.COMPOSITE and updates.get(EMBARGO):
            update_schedule_settings(updated, EMBARGO, updated.get(EMBARGO))
            get_resource_service(ARCHIVE).validate_embargo(updated)

        if self.publish_type in [ITEM_CORRECT, ITEM_KILL]:
            if updates.get(EMBARGO) and not original.get(EMBARGO):
                raise SuperdeskApiError.badRequestError("Embargo can't be set after publishing")

        if self.publish_type in [ITEM_CORRECT, ITEM_KILL]:
            if updates.get('dateline'):
                raise SuperdeskApiError.badRequestError("Dateline can't be modified after publishing")

        if self.publish_type == ITEM_PUBLISH and updated.get('rewritten_by'):
            # if update is published then user cannot publish the takes
            rewritten_by = get_resource_service(ARCHIVE).find_one(req=None, _id=updated.get('rewritten_by'))
            if rewritten_by and rewritten_by.get(ITEM_STATE) in PUBLISH_STATES:
                raise SuperdeskApiError.badRequestError("Cannot publish the story after Update is published.!")

        publish_type = 'auto_publish' if updates.get('auto_publish') else self.publish_type
        validate_item = {'act': publish_type, 'type': original['type'], 'validate': updated}
        validation_errors = get_resource_service('validate').post([validate_item])
        if validation_errors[0]:
            raise ValidationError(validation_errors)

        validation_errors = []
        self._validate_associated_items(original, takes_package, validation_errors)

        if original[ITEM_TYPE] == CONTENT_TYPE.COMPOSITE:
            self._validate_package(original, updates, validation_errors)

        if len(validation_errors) > 0:
            raise ValidationError(validation_errors)

    def on_update(self, updates, original):
        self.raise_if_not_marked_for_publication(original)
        self.raise_if_invalid_state_transition(original)

        updated = original.copy()
        updated.update(updates)

        takes_package = self.takes_package_service.get_take_package(original)

        if self.publish_type == 'publish':
            # validate if take can be published
            if takes_package and not self.takes_package_service.can_publish_take(
                    takes_package,
                    updates.get(SEQUENCE, original.get(SEQUENCE, 1))):
                raise PublishQueueError.previous_take_not_published_error(
                    Exception("Previous takes are not published."))

            validate_schedule(
                updated.get('publish_schedule'),
                takes_package.get(SEQUENCE, 1) if takes_package else 1)

            if original[ITEM_TYPE] != CONTENT_TYPE.COMPOSITE and updates.get(
                    EMBARGO):
                get_resource_service(ARCHIVE).validate_embargo(updated)

        if self.publish_type in ['correct', 'kill']:
            if updates.get(EMBARGO):
                raise SuperdeskApiError.badRequestError(
                    "Embargo can't be set after publishing")

            if updates.get('dateline'):
                raise SuperdeskApiError.badRequestError(
                    "Dateline can't be modified after publishing")

        validate_item = {
            'act': self.publish_type,
            'type': original['type'],
            'validate': updated
        }
        validation_errors = get_resource_service('validate').post(
            [validate_item])
        if validation_errors[0]:
            raise ValidationError(validation_errors)

        # validate the package if it is one
        package_validation_errors = []
        self._validate_package_contents(original, takes_package,
                                        package_validation_errors)
        if len(package_validation_errors) > 0:
            raise ValidationError(package_validation_errors)

        self._set_updates(original, updates,
                          updates.get(config.LAST_UPDATED, utcnow()))
